I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Vos Contributions VBScript Discussion :

améliorer InputBox Versions Fr et US [Sources]


Sujet :

Vos Contributions VBScript

Mode arborescent

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Rédacteur
    Avatar de omen999
    Profil pro
    Inscrit en
    Février 2006
    Messages
    1 302
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Février 2006
    Messages : 1 302
    Par défaut améliorer InputBox Versions Fr et US
    bonjour,
    je replace ici le petit outil que j'avais écrit pour étendre les possibilités de la fonction inputbox.
    J'ajoute que cet outil est en réalité utilisable dans toutes les versions localisées de Windows et pas seulement dans la version française en modifiant le nom du launcher.
    (ex: pour la version allemande, renommer wshFRA.dll en wshDEU.dll)
    extrait du lisezmoi:
    Le langage VBScript est un outil très commode, notamment pour les administrateurs réseaux, mais l'interface utilisateur a été réduite à la portion congrue avec ses deux fonctions MsgBox et InputBox.

    Il existait essentiellement deux solutions pour pallier cette déficience:

    – Les feuilles HTA exploitant le moteur graphique d'Internet Explorer
    – Les contrôles ActiveX Automation spécialement dédiés

    La première est lourde à mettre en œuvre et la seconde impose l'inscription du composant dans la base de registre, ce qui n'est pas toujours possible.

    La présente extension utilise une troisième voie originale (à ma connaissance…) à savoir la modification dynamique de la boîte de dialogue affichée par la fonction InputBox pour ajouter deux fonctionnalités:

    1°: Remplacement du champ texte par un champ combo de type dropdown ou dropdownlist.

    2°: L'ajout d'un champ mot de passe d'une largeur de 6 à 40 caractères.

    Il s'agit surtout d'une preuve de concept puisque d'autres types de contrôles pourraient a priori être ajoutés.

    Normalement utilisable pour toutes versions de Windows® mais testé uniquement avec W2K et XP SP1.

    Important: Cette version ne fonctionne qu'avec la version localisée française de MS Windows®.
    Fichiers attachés Fichiers attachés
    nomen omen, nemo non omen - Consultez la FAQ VBScript et les cours et tutoriels VBScript
    le plus terrible lorsqu'une voiture renverse un piéton, c'est que ce sont les freins qui hurlent. (ramón)
    pas de questions techniques par mp

Discussions similaires

  1. amélioration SQL2012 Version Entreprise
    Par Boubou2020 dans le forum Administration
    Réponses: 1
    Dernier message: 28/05/2015, 11h43
  2. Réponses: 24
    Dernier message: 07/07/2008, 08h42
  3. [.NET Winforms] InputBox (InputBox amélioré)
    Par SaumonAgile dans le forum Mon programme
    Réponses: 3
    Dernier message: 27/07/2007, 19h34
  4. [outil]Améliorer la fonction InputBox
    Par omen999 dans le forum VBScript
    Réponses: 1
    Dernier message: 03/01/2007, 15h09

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o